Ian Filby

Filby began his career in the youth system at Second Division club Orient and signed his first professional contract on his 18th birthday in October 1972.

[1] Filby moved to Canada to join North American Soccer League club Montreal Olympique on loan for the 1973 season.

[2] Manager Graham Adams commented that Filby was faster and had better ball control than the previous season's highly rated Scottish player Graeme Souness.

[2] Filby was loaned to Brentford, St Mirren and Romford during the 1974–75 season and departed Orient at the end of the campaign.

[2] Filby returned to North America to sign for American Soccer League club Sacramento Gold in 1979.
